Transaction 28926112f1002d97545bba60ec8c44ef2269398ae56d57554a25c3602db6ee5b
1 Input
1 Output
-
28926112f1002d97545bba60ec8c44ef2269398ae56d57554a25c3602db6ee5b:0
- value
- 1866105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2bd8d2b8bd3e6e42932af16a1dfad10f3bd2d7c OP_EQUAL
- address
- 3LuJu6NinNV7NSoV3BHwm6JdvvX4isE3dW